Breaking Down the 4u2 Jelly Tint Formula

One of the biggest complaints about long-lasting lip products is the texture. Matte formulas can feel heavy and drying, often cracking and flaking as the day goes on. Glossy tints, on the other hand, can feel sticky and tacky, like a magnet for stray hairs and dust. This is where the 4u2 Jelly Tint changes the game with its unique formulation. The secret lies in its name: the “jelly” texture.

Unlike traditional oil- or wax-based lipsticks, this tint has a high water content, giving it a lightweight, gel-like consistency. When you first apply it, it glides onto your lips with a cooling, refreshing sensation. There’s no stickiness or tackiness. Instead, it feels smooth and hydrating, delivering a juicy, plump finish that makes lips look healthy and vibrant.

Here’s what happens after application:

  1. Initial Glide: The jelly formula spreads effortlessly, allowing you to build up the color to your desired intensity.
  2. Setting Phase: The water in the formula begins to evaporate, leaving behind a flexible film of color pigments. This process is what creates the long-lasting stain effect.
  3. Final Finish: Once set, the tint feels virtually weightless. It doesn't create a thick, heavy layer on your lips. Instead, it fuses with your skin to create a natural-looking stain that is both breathable and comfortable.

This technology ensures that your lips don’t feel parched or tight, even after hours of wear in the heat. The formula is designed to move with your lips, preventing the cracking and flaking associated with many matte liquid lipsticks. This means you get the longevity of a powerful stain without sacrificing comfort, making it the ideal choice for a long, hot day when the last thing you want is to be aware of the heavy product on your lips.

Real-World Wear Test: Sweat, Masks, and Meals

A product can have the most innovative formula in the world, but the real question is: how does it perform in real life? To find out, we put the 4u2 Jelly Tint through a typical day filled with the ultimate challenges: sweat, face masks, and food. The goal was to see if it truly lives up to its claims of being transfer-proof and sweat-resistant.

The test began with a fresh application in the morning. The tint glided on smoothly, and after letting it set for about a minute, the initial glossy finish settled into a soft, natural-looking stain.

The Iced Coffee and Water Test: The first challenge was the morning beverage. Sipping on an iced coffee and drinking water from a bottle throughout the morning resulted in minimal transfer. While a very faint hint of color was visible on the straw and bottle rim, the color on the lips remained vibrant and even. The tint did not bleed or smudge around the edges.

The Sweat and Humidity Test: Next came a walk outside during the hottest part of the day. As expected, sweat formed around the mouth area. However, the lip tint held its ground remarkably well. The color did not melt, run, or become patchy. The sweat-resistant properties were clear, as the tint remained locked in place, proving it could withstand the daily exposure to high humidity.

The Lunch Test: The biggest challenge for any lip product is a meal, especially one with oils. After eating a moderately oily lunch, some of the color in the center of the lips had faded. This is a realistic outcome, as oils are known to break down even the most stubborn makeup. However, the outer edges of the tint remained intact, leaving behind a soft, gradient effect rather than a harsh, unflattering ring. A quick, light touch-up was all that was needed to restore the color to its original vibrancy.

The Face Mask Test: Throughout the day, a face mask was worn intermittently. This is often the ultimate test of transfer resistance. After several hours, the inside of the mask showed almost no color transfer. This is a major advantage for anyone who needs to wear a mask for extended periods and wants to avoid the messy, smudged look.

The verdict? The 4u2 Jelly Tint performs exceptionally well under pressure. While it may require a minor touch-up after a heavy meal, its ability to resist sweat, humidity, and mask transfer makes it a highly reliable choice for all-day wear.

How to Apply for a Flawless, Non-Patchy Finish

One of the main concerns with any lip tint is the fear of a patchy or uneven application. Because tints are designed to stain the skin, mistakes can be difficult to correct. However, with the right preparation and technique, you can achieve a smooth, flawless finish that lasts all day. The key is to create the perfect canvas and apply the product strategically.

Step 1: Prep Your Lips A smooth application starts with smooth lips. Tints can cling to dry patches, resulting in an uneven look.

  • Exfoliate Gently: Use a mild lip scrub or a soft, damp washcloth to gently buff away any dead skin. This creates a uniform surface for the tint to adhere to.
  • Hydrate Lightly: Apply a thin layer of a lightweight, non-oily lip balm. Let it absorb for a few minutes, then blot away any excess with a tissue. You want your lips to be hydrated, not greasy, as oil can prevent the tint from setting properly.

Step 2: The Application Technique How you apply the tint is just as important as the prep work. Avoid swiping it on like a traditional lipstick. Instead, use the applicator to place the product strategically.

  • Start in the Center: Dab a small amount of the jelly tint onto the center of your bottom and top lips. This is where you want the most color concentration for a natural, gradient effect.
  • Blend Outwards: Use your fingertip or a clean lip brush to gently tap and blend the color outwards towards the edges of your lips. This technique gives you more control and prevents the color from bleeding outside your lip line. Tapping motions help press the pigment into the skin for a longer-lasting stain.
  • Avoid Rubbing Your Lips Together: Immediately after application, resist the urge to press your lips together. Let the tint set for at least 60 seconds. This allows the film-forming agents to work their magic and lock the color in place, which is crucial for minimizing transfer.

Step 3: Build and Blot for Longevity If you want a more intense color payoff that lasts even longer, layering is your best friend.

  • Apply a Thin First Layer: Follow the steps above to apply a sheer, even layer.
  • Blot Gently: Take a single-ply tissue and gently press it against your lips. This removes the excess gloss and moisture, leaving behind the pure stain.
  • Apply a Second Layer: Dab a little more product onto the center of your lips and blend it out. This second layer will deepen the color and reinforce the stain.

By following these simple steps, you can ensure your 4u2 Jelly Tint applies beautifully and stays put, giving you that effortless, non-patchy look you desire.

Choosing Your Shade: What to Expect on Different Skin Tones

Finding the right lip shade can feel like a challenge, especially when you can’t swatch them in person. The beauty of a jelly tint is its translucent, buildable nature, which allows it to adapt beautifully to a wide range of skin tones. Instead of masking your natural lip color with an opaque layer, it enhances it, creating a “your lips but better” effect. Here’s how you can expect some of the popular shades to appear on different undertones.

For Fair to Light Skin Tones: On fairer skin, shades with pink, coral, or soft red undertones look particularly fresh and vibrant.

  • A soft rose or baby pink shade will provide a delicate, natural-looking flush of color, perfect for an everyday, no-makeup makeup look.
  • A bright cherry or strawberry shade will appear as a bold yet translucent pop of color, brightening the entire complexion without looking too heavy.
  • Peachy and coral tints can warm up the skin tone, giving it a healthy, sun-kissed glow.

For Medium to Olive Skin Tones: Medium skin tones have a versatile base that works well with a wide spectrum of colors, from warm oranges to deep berries.

  • Warm terracotta or brick red shades complement the golden or olive undertones in the skin, creating a sophisticated and earthy look. These shades can make you look effortlessly polished.
  • A deep berry or plum tint will provide a rich, moody stain that stands out beautifully against medium skin. It can be applied sheerly for a hint of color or built up for a more dramatic effect.
  • Bright fuchsia or magenta shades can offer a stunning contrast, creating a fun and confident statement lip.

For Deep to Rich Skin Tones: On deeper skin tones, shades with rich, warm, and highly-pigmented undertones are especially flattering. The translucency of the jelly tint prevents them from looking flat.

  • Rich wine or burgundy shades deliver a gorgeous, deep stain that enhances the natural richness of the lips. They provide a look of refined elegance.
  • A vibrant, warm-toned red will appear as a powerful yet wearable pop of color. It won't look as stark as an opaque lipstick, but it will certainly make a statement.
  • Even deep brown or mahogany shades work well, creating a sophisticated '90s-inspired look that defines the lips while still feeling modern and fresh due to the jelly finish.

The key is to remember that these tints are meant to enhance, not cover. The final color will always be a unique combination of the tint’s pigment and your own natural lip color, ensuring a result that is uniquely and effortlessly you.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

  1. Q: How many hours can you expect the 4u2 jelly tint to last in direct sun and high humidity?
    A: While no product is entirely immune to extreme conditions, this tint is impressively resilient. You can expect the core stain to last for 6-8 hours. The initial juicy finish may fade after a few hours, but it will transition gracefully into a natural-looking tint that stays put through sweat.
  2. Q: Why does the jelly texture feel different from standard matte tints, and will it dry out your lips?
    A: The jelly texture comes from a water-based formula with flexible film-formers. Unlike heavy matte tints that can feel tight and shrink as they dry, this formula remains pliable and breathable. It is designed to be comfortable and non-drying, so your lips feel hydrated throughout the day.
  3. Q: Is it safe to wear this formula all day without reapplying, and when is the best time for a touch-up?
    A: Yes, the formula is safe for all-day wear. It feels lightweight and comfortable on the lips. The best time for a quick touch-up is typically after eating a heavy or oily meal, as oils are more effective at breaking down the tint's color film than water or sweat.
  4. Q: How can you test if the tint will transfer onto your mask or coffee cup before leaving the house?
    A: Apply a thin, even layer and let it set for at least 60 seconds without pressing your lips together. Afterward, gently blot your lips with a tissue. If little to no color comes off on the tissue, you can be confident that transfer onto your mask or cup will be minimal.
